Is there anyway of increasing the FTP Timeout at all?

Reason being that from time to time my VPS I have cumulus on will be under load and Cumulus will timeout, but I get a error light flashing until I clear it then, and really I don't mind the timeout

Re: FTp Timeout

Posted: Mon 27 Feb 2012 8:26 am
by steve
I think the timeout is already 30 seconds, I increased it from 20 seconds some time ago. If you don't want the error light to flash for ftp timeouts, disable it in the display settings.
